摘  要:以岩心相分析为基础,综合储层岩性、沉积构造及粒度等方面特征,确定了新庄油田Eh_3Ⅰ-Ⅲ储层为扇三角洲沉积体系。其主要发育扇三角洲前缘亚相,微相包括水下分流河道、河口坝、边缘砂和席状砂4类;建立了扇三角洲三维空间相模式,对沉积相平面展布规律进行了分析;探讨了沉积相对储层物性及含油性的控制作用,为储层的综合评价及有利储集相带预测奠定了地质基础。Based on core facies analysis and in combination with lithology, sedimentary structures and rock grain size, it is believed that Reservoir Eha I - III in Xinzhuang Oilfield deposited in a fan - delta sedimentary system. Fan - delta front sub - facies is predominant and microfacies include underwater distributary channel, mouth bar, marginal sandbody and sand sheet A three - dimensional facies mode of fan- delta is built; the lateral distribution pattern of sedimentary facies is analyzed; and the control of sedimentary facies on reservoir physical properties and oil -bearing properties is discussed. These studies lay a geological foundation for comprehensive evaluation of reservoirs and prediction of favorable reservoir facies belts.
